Pork Chops

πŸ– This Juicy Skillet Pork Chops Recipe for Tender, Flavorful Dinner delivers perfectly cooked, juicy pork chops with a savory pan sauce for an elevated weeknight meal.
🍳 The combination of a spiced crust and a rich apple cider pan sauce creates a deliciously balanced dish that’s easy to prepare and sure to impress.

  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ale

4 pork chops (about 6 ounces each, 1-inch thick)

Salt (to taste)

1 tablespoon all-purpose flour

1 teaspoon chili powder

1 teaspoon garlic powder

1 teaspoon onion powder

1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ika

1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per

1 tablespoon avocado oil or vegetable oil

1 cup low-sodium chicken stock for pan sauce

1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ar for pan sauce

2 teaspoons honey or brown sugar for pan sauce

1 tablespoon butter for pan sauce

2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ley optional, for pan sauce

Instructions

1-Remove the pork chops from the refrigerator and season both sides generously with salt. Let them rest at room temperature for 30 minutes to enhance flavor and promote even cooking.

2-In a small bowl, mix together 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on chili powder, 1 teaspoon garlic powder, 1 teaspoon onion powder, 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ika, and 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per to make a seasoning rub.

3-Pat the pork chops dry with paper towels, then rub the spice mixture evenly onto both sides of each chop for a flavorful crust.

4-Heat 1 tablespoon avocado oil or vegetable oil in a sk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Add the pork chops and cook for 2-3 minutes per side until golden brown. If the chops have a fatty side, sear it for 30 seconds after flipping.

5-Reduce the heat to low, cover the skillet, and cook the pork chops for 6-12 minutes, checking regularly, until the internal temperature reaches 145Β°F (63Β°C).

6-Transfer the cooked pork chops to a plate, cover loosely with foil, and let them rest for 5 minutes to let the juices redistribute.

7-To make the pan sauce, increase the skillet heat to medium-high. Add 1 cup low-sodium chicken stock, 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ar, and 2 teaspoons honey or brown sugar. Simmer while scraping up browned bits until the liquid reduces by half.

8-Remove the skillet from the heat and stir in 1 tablespoon butter until melted.

9-Return the rested pork chops to the skillet and turn them to coat evenly in the sauce.

10-Serve immediately, garnished with 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ley if desired. The total preparation time is about 45 minutes, with 30 minutes prep and 15 minutes cook.

Notes

πŸ– Use pork chops at least 1-inch thick for best results; bone-in adds more flavor.
⏲️ Bring chops to room temperature and salt 30 minutes ahead for even cooking and enhanced flavor.
πŸ”₯ Sear first then cover and cook on low to retain moisture and develop a crust.
